On the project

Metasurfaces represent novel optical components made of precisely aligned nanostructures that can control the amplitude, polarization, or direction of light waves. Incorporating a phase-change material into nanostructures allows for tuning the function of already fabricated metasurfaces. This incorporation can result in tunable beam steering devices, promising for future LiDAR systems. The main goal of this project is to design and fabricate a tunable beam steering device made of hybrid silicon and phase-change vanadium dioxide nanostructures.
